Sheffie Posted March 25, 2005 #2 Share Posted March 25, 2005 Hi, Michelle, this is Michelle! You are in for a treat. Cruising is fantastic! Some things that are not included are your alcoholic drinks, pop (you are from Canada, so you know what I mean!), spa treatments, and photographs. What is included: meals, (and if you want more or something different after you have tried something, you can do that!) activities, shows, fun, relaxation and the best pampering you have had since you were a baby! Hotels in Miami...there are TONS, most people do "priceline" and get awesome deals on some of the nicer ones in the area (check out the "Hotels, Pre-Post Cruise" board for more). As far as what's not included in your price...spa treatments, possibly the reservations-only supper club (versus the standard dining room), a lot of the private "lessons" (golf comes to mind), drinks (with a few exceptions, which I *think* varies from cruiseline to cruiseline, check out Royal Caribbean for more info on that), excursions, some after dinner beverages (again, depending on the cruiseline), tips (varying from cruiseline to cruiseline, again). Basically, the things that ARE included are the port charges/taxes, stateroom, meals in the dining room, most/if not all of the lectures/contests/games, room service, housekeeping. good luck finding your answers and planning the rest of your trip. you'll learn a LOT on these boards...let me tell you, it's a nice feeling to go into something you've never done before being prepared. hope that helps.
